Keys and
key signatures are two separate (but related) concepts.
Keys are a sonic/musical reality, while
key signatures are an abstract notational device.
Our ears tell us there are 24
keys in western music: one major key for each note of the 12-tone chromatic scale, and one minor key for each note of the 12-tone chromatic scale.
Key signatures are a shorthand that we've invented to make notated sheet music easier to read. Theoretically it is not "necessary" to use key signatures at all! Any song can be notated in any key signature. For example, John Coltrane's "Giant Steps" is often notated with a key signature of 0 sharps and 0 flats. But that doesn't mean "Giant Steps" is in C major (or A minor)! It's just notated that way because it's easier to read.
Our standard system of music notation is flawed and imperfect. It has accumulated a lot of quirky features along the way throughout its history. For example, a common beginner question, "Why does the major scale start on C? Wouldn't it make more sense to start on A?"
Because of these flaws in standard music notation, there are certain key signatures that exist in theory, but aren't commonly used because the notation is awkward. For example, imagine we are playing in C# (7 sharps) and we want to modulate to the key of G#. Modulating up a perfect 5th is called the "dominant key" and is probably the most common modulation in all of music history. If you are following the Victor Wooten video, you might say, "G# major is not allowed, because there are only 15 major keys, and you can only have 7 sharps." But Ab major (4 flats) is "allowed" so you might choose to notate your song in C# with a modulation to Ab. Awkward!!
But in fact there
is a key of G# major. It has 8 sharps, or more accurately, 6 sharps and a double-sharp (F##). Look at a composition such as "Prelude and Fugue no. 3" from J.S. Bach's "Well Tempered Clavier." It is notated in the key signature of C# major and modulates to the dominant key of G# major. Bach accomplishes this modulation through the use of F## just as we would expect.
Victor Wooten teaches that there are 15 major keys and 15 minor keys for a total of 30. But that is simply a limitation or quirk in our notation system. The 30 keys he's talking about are the ones that can be written without using double-sharps or double-flats. But given that double-flats and double-sharps are a "thing" that exists, we have to conclude that keys like G# major or Fb minor do theoretically "exist". Even good old C major can be written enharmonically as B# major! We don't avoid these keys because they "don't exist" but rather because they are cumbersome to read, with all the double-flats and double-sharps. In theory, every key signature has at least one enharmonic equivalent; in practice, the only enharmonic keys that are commonly encountered are the ones that are easy to read and write: Db/C#, Gb/F#, and Cb/B.
In conclusion, there are 24
keys (12 major and 12 minor), at least 48
theoretical key signatures (24 major and 24 minor), and 30
practical key signatures (15 major and 15 minor) that are typically encountered in the real world.
It's important not to get hung up on the significance of the number 15. The truly significant number is 12 (because the octave is divided into 12 parts), whereas 15 is just an artifact or quirk of our notation system. My grandpa used to do a magic trick where he tried to convince me he had 11 fingers. The 3 "extra" key signatures (bringing the total from 12 to 15) are "enharmonic equivalents" or "two different names for the same thing." F# and Gb are undoubtedly two different
key signatures, but saying they are two different
keys is like my grandpa counting the same finger twice!
